Testing: RE: Fixed menu

 

Hi Israel,
Just to add to what Nio has found: the 'Places' menu reveals no items (Live and Installed) until 'Reload Desktop' is performed.

> Hi Israel,
> 
> I downloaded
> 
> 7572260efaed597a3508e60ab5e68f30  ToriOS-2016-06-06-beta-jessie.iso
> 
> Live:
> 
> It still needs 'Reload Desktop' to show the whole menu. Otherwise it is 
> like before (illustrated by Jack and me for the previous iso file). This 
> is a minor bug, but it is ugly, and I suggest that you try to fix it.
> 
> The network widget is there in the panel, and the network works.
> 
> Should it be that people must run
> 
> update-command-not-found
> 
> to find the database of available applications? I'm only asking, not 
> demanding that it should be fixed, because I realize that you had to 
> remove things to make the iso file within CD size.
> 
> Shutdown in the menu is only shutdown, no reboot etc. Is this the 
> intention (simplied to decrease the size)?
> 
> -o-
> 
> Installing:
> 
> Installing at the basic OBI level works.
> 
> Installing at the advanced OBI level works.
> 
> I created a tarball with zmktbl, but failed to install from that tarball 
> to another drive. There were some strange errors. I'll try again after 
> rebooting. (Maybe things were mixed up because I did not reboot between 
> zmktbl and the obi-installer.)
> 
> Yes, after saving the custom tarball to my main computer, rebooting into 
> ToriOS live and getting the custom tarball I could install a working 
> system from it :-)
> 
> -o-
> 
> Installed:
> 
> It still needs 'Reload Desktop' to show the whole menu. Otherwise it is 
> like before (illustrated by Jack and me for the previous iso file).
> 
> I tested firstrun: it works to run ztweaks.
> 
> mkusb seems to work - I tested only the menus, not installing.
> 
> The tango palette is no longer set in sakura, so the prompt is grey 
> again. (minor bug - need not be fixed)
> 
> After next reboot the tango palette has survived, but it still needs 
> 'Reload Desktop' to show the whole menu.
> 
> update & dist-upgrade works.
> 
> Summary:
> 
> I think this daily iso file is very close to release - I would like the 
> menu to be complete without 'Reload Desktop' - otherwise it is fine :-)
> 
> Now let us wait for feedback from the other guys ...
